CS 3500 Achieves High Marks in ADA Accuracy Study

A recent professional product review by the American Dental Association found the CS 3500 intraoral scanner to be among the top of its class in accuracy.

Evaluation of the Accuracy of Six Intraoral Scanning Devices: An in-vitro Investigation,” conducted by Gary Hacks, D.D.S., and Sebastian Patzelt, D.M.D., took into consideration six different intraoral scanners. For this study, a model was scanned with a very high accuracy scanner and used as a reference. Three scans were taken with each scanner. Two factors were evaluated—the “trueness” (accuracy) and “precision” of each of the data sets.

In the category of trueness, or how accurately the scanner represented the reference model, the CS 3500 performed well (9.8 ± 0.8 µm). Accuracy was determined by the “smallest deviations for the trueness measurements (± standard deviation) between the reference dataset and the various intraoral scanner datasets.” Essentially, the CS 3500’s scans varied less from the model significantly compared to other scanners.

“If you were to think in terms of a bullseye, not only were all of CS 3500’s results closer to the center, they were grouped tighter as well,” Edward Shellard, DMD, vice president, sales and marketing, said.

The study also considered precision, essentially measuring how consistent the results from the scanner were. Again, the CS 3500 performed well, coming out ahead of other scanners.

The CS 3500 allows practitioners to easily acquire true color, 2D and 3D images and requires no external heater or trolley system. Additionally, the CS 3500 uses open-format STL files for easy sharing and can be plugged directly into a computer’s USB—making it a truly portable. Carestream Dental’s 3D HD imaging is available with all three workflows of the CS 3500 acquisition software —restorative, orthodontic and implant.
